  • Leven Beach: Located a mile from the Lochs and Glens North Cycle Route, Leven Beach offers a stunning sandy shoreline perfect for relaxing, beachcombing, or enjoying a seaside picnic. Its vibrant atmosphere and scenic views make it an ideal spot to unwind.
  • University of St. Andrews: A mere 8.1km away, this historic university is steeped in rich tradition and culture. Explore its ancient buildings, beautiful grounds, and the iconic Old Course, making it a must-visit for history and architecture enthusiasts.
  • Falkland Palace: Situated 5.6km from the cycle route, Falkland Palace is a stunning Renaissance palace surrounded by exquisite gardens. This historic site offers a glimpse into royal life and remarkable architecture, perfect for those with a passion for history.

Best time to go to Lochs and Glens North Cycle Route

The best time to visit Lochs and Glens North Cycle Route is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January37.9°F (3.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February38.8°F (3.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March41.2°F (5.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April44.6°F (7.0°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udyAverageAverage
May49.3°F (9.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June54.3°F (12.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July57.6°F (14.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
August56.8°F (13.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
September53.8°F (12.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
October48.7°F (9.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November43.0°F (6.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December39.0°F (3.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
